How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Palms?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Palms Studio Apartments | $2,605 | $1,295 | $7,075 |
Palms 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,322 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
Palms 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,342 | $1,640 | $10,000+ |
Palms 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,431 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|
Palms 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,644 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|
Palms 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,229 | $1,662 | $6,995 |
Palms 6 Bedroom Apartments | $1,975 | $1,975 | $1,975 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Palms
How much are Studio apartments in Palms?
There are currently 3,250 Studio Apartments in Palms with rent ranges from $1,195 to $7,075 with an average price of $3,649.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Palms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Palms ranges from $1,350 to $12,429 with an average monthly rent of $3,322.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Palms c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Palms range from $1,640 to $16,467.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,342.
How expensive are Palms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,102 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Palms on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,280 to $34,500 - averaging $5,431 for the location.
